Self-balancing type turning attachment
Technical field
The utility model relates to a kind of production line balance fixture, particularly relates to a kind of vertical lathe fixture with automatic balance function.
Background technology
Automated manufacturing system refers under less artificial directly or indirectly intervention, raw material is processed into part or assembling parts is become product, realizing management process and Technics Process Automation in process.For the automatic processing system of part, usually requiring every procedure energy balance in man-hour, so that the lathe of streamline can have good utilization rate, in order to realize balance in man-hour, usually will carry out twice installation.The solution commonly used for once mounting at present carries out counterweigh, and the simple and practical method for the balance of the turning attachment repeatedly installed has no.
Utility model content
The purpose of this utility model is to overcome the deficiencies in the prior art, adapts to reality need, provides one can realize self balancing vertical lathe fixture.
In order to realize the purpose of this utility model, the technical solution adopted in the utility model is:
The utility model discloses a kind of self-balancing type turning attachment, comprise a clamping fixture table be connected with machine tool chief axis, the top of described clamping fixture table is provided with holder, described clamping fixture table comprises a upper cover plate and a lower cover, described upper cover plate and lower cover are oppositely arranged the equipment cavity being buckled together a formation hollow, be provided with balance weight in described equipment cavity, described balance weight is driven by external force and does horizontal movement, is also provided with guide pad and limited block.
Described balance weight drives horizontal slip by the piston rod of hydraulic cylinder or cylinder, or by electric push rod horizontal slip, the free end of described piston rod or pull bar is divided into two legs, be connected with the both sides of balance weight respectively by two legs and carry out push-and-pull to balance weight, described limited block is arranged between two legs.
The inside front ends of described balance weight is provided with two springs, and the front end of described spring is provided with spring block.
Described balance weight is divided into left balance weight, right balance weight, and described left balance weight, right balance weight are connected with respective piston rod or pull bar.
Described cylinder or hydraulic cylinder are driven by automatic control system, and described automatic control system comprises single-chip microcomputer.
Described holder comprises the support nail of the setting of vertical direction, fine positioning pin, pre-determined bit pin and corner hydraulic cylinder, and the piston rod upper end of described corner hydraulic cylinder is provided with the depression bar of level.
Described guide pad is provided with left guide pad, right guide pad, and the top of described left guide pad, right guide pad is fixedly installed pressing plate, and guide pad and pressing plate form guide pad assembly.
Described left guide pad, right guide pad include two pieces, two pieces of guide pads lay respectively at balance weight two outside and balance weight is clamped.
The beneficial effects of the utility model are:
1., for the turning attachment of needs twice installation, automatically can realize balance;
2. reduce the vibrations and the noise that add man-hour, improve machining accuracy and the surface quality of part;
3. realize the operation balance in man-hour of automation processing line.

Detailed description of the invention
Below in conjunction with drawings and Examples, the utility model is further illustrated:
Embodiment: see Fig. 1---Fig. 3.
The utility model discloses a kind of self-balancing type turning attachment, comprise a clamping fixture table 9 be connected with machine tool chief axis 8, the top of described clamping fixture table 9 is provided with holder, described holder comprises the support nail 1 of the setting of vertical direction, fine positioning pin 2, pre-determined bit pin 3 and corner hydraulic cylinder 4, and the piston rod upper end of described corner hydraulic cylinder 4 is provided with the depression bar 41 of level.Above the support nail 1 workpiece to be held being placed on clamping fixture table 9, three support nails 1 of dispersed placement above clamping fixture table 9 limit workpiece three degree of freedom, two pre-determined bit pins 3 realize workpiece pre-determined bit, two fine positioning pin 2(mono-are rhombus pin) limit workpiece three degree of freedom, drive depression bar 41 vertical direction to move the clamping realizing workpiece by corner hydraulic jack 4.Described clamping fixture table comprises a upper cover plate 91 and a lower cover 92, described upper cover plate 91 is oppositely arranged with lower cover 92 equipment cavity 93 being buckled together a formation hollow, balance weight is provided with in described equipment cavity 93, described balance weight is driven by external force and does horizontal movement, is also provided with guide pad 7 and limited block 8.
Described guide pad is provided with left guide pad 71, right guide pad 72, and the top of described left guide pad 71, right guide pad 72 is fixedly installed pressing plate 73, and guide pad and pressing plate 73 form guide pad assembly.Described left guide pad 71, right guide pad 72 include two pieces, two pieces of guide pads lay respectively at balance weight two outside and balance weight is clamped.Guide pad 7 and pressing plate 73 form guide pad assembly, and linking together by securing member, can make the guide pad assembly matched with it according to the exterior contour of balance weight, can be widget by this segmentation again, are convenient to processing assembling.
Described balance weight drives horizontal slip by the piston rod of hydraulic cylinder or cylinder, this process also can be achieved by power supply drive by a pull bar, the free end of described piston rod or electric push rod is divided into two legs, be connected with the both sides of balance weight respectively by two legs and carry out push-and-pull to balance weight, described limited block 10 is arranged between two legs.Described balance weight is divided into left balance weight 51, right balance weight 52, and described left balance weight 51, right balance weight 52 are connected with respective cylinder or hydraulic cylinder piston rod.In figure, left balance weight 51, right balance weight 52 carry out push-and-pull by the piston rod of left oil cylinder 61, right oil cylinder 62 respectively.
The inside front ends of left balance weight 51, right balance weight 52 is provided with two springs 53, and the front end of described spring 53 is provided with spring block 54.When two balance weights are moved to inside by respective piston rod, by spring 53 and spring block 54 acting in conjunction, spring 53 is compressed, and prevents balance weight quick sliding to clash into the miscellaneous part in equipment cavity 93, ensure that the smooth sliding of balance weight.
Left oil cylinder 61, right oil cylinder 62 can pass through human users's button, calculated in advance goes out distance and the time that two balance weights need slip, it is controlled, this process also can automation, is namely driven by automatic control system, and Three-dimensional Design Software calculates amount of unbalance when holder is installed for twice, the balance of twice installation is realized by the distance of two balance weight horizontal slips, this simple process, can be realized by the single-chip microcomputer with program controlled software, be not repeated herein.
